Jamar Scarborough

Citizen Astronaut Program Applicant At Space For Humanity at Space for Humanity

Jamar Scarborough has a diverse background in security and protection services, with experience in executive protection for various production companies. Currently, Jamar serves as the Chief Scientist at HI-SEAS (Hawaii Space Exploration Analog & Simulation) and is also an applicant for the Citizen Astronaut Program at Space for Humanity. Jamar has also held positions in law enforcement and emergency management at organizations like the U.S. Department of Homeland Security, the Federal Bureau of Investigation, and FEMA. In terms of education, Jamar holds degrees in Instructional Design and Technology, Personal Protection Specialist, Emergency Management, Business Administration, and is currently pursuing a Doctor's Degree in Business Administration Information Systems.
